마크다운 vs 워드: 어떤 걸 써야 할까?
문서를 작성할 때 가장 먼저 결정해야 할 것은 어떤 도구를 사용할 것인가입니다. 가장 대중적인 도구인 Microsoft Word와 개발자를 중심으로 확산되고 있는 마크다운, 두 도구의 특성을 비교해보고 어떤 상황에서 어떤 도구가 적합한지 알아보겠습니다.
한눈에 보는 비교
| 항목 | 마크다운 | Microsoft Word |
|---|---|---|
| 학습 난이도 | 쉬움 | 보통 |
| 파일 크기 | 매우 작음 | 큼 |
| 버전 관리 | 우수 (Git 호환) | 제한적 |
| 협업 | Git 기반 | 실시간 공동 편집 |
| 서식 자유도 | 제한적 | 매우 높음 |
| 플랫폼 지원 | 모든 플랫폼 | Windows/Mac |
| 비용 | 무료 | 유료 |
| 호환성 | 순수 텍스트 | .docx 형식 |
| 인쇄/레이아웃 | 도구 필요 | 바로 가능 |
| 수학 공식 | LaTeX 지원 | 내장 수식 편집기 |
마크다운의 장점
1. 어디서든 열 수 있다
마크다운 파일은 순수 텍스트이므로 메모장부터 VS Code까지 어떤 텍스트 편집기에서든 열 수 있습니다. 10년 후에도 문제없이 읽을 수 있다는 것은 큰 장점입니다.
# 마크다운 파일은 이렇게 생겼습니다
- 어떤 에디터에서든 열 수 있습니다
- 별도의 프로그램이 필요 없습니다
- **서식 정보**도 텍스트로 표현됩니다
반면 Word 파일(.docx)은 Microsoft Word나 호환 프로그램이 있어야 정상적으로 열립니다. 호환 프로그램에서 열면 레이아웃이 깨지는 경우도 흔합니다.
2. 버전 관리가 쉽다
마크다운은 텍스트 기반이므로 Git으로 완벽하게 버전 관리가 가능합니다.
# 변경 내용을 한눈에 확인
git diff document.md
# 변경 사항:
# - 기존: 서버 응답 시간은 평균 200ms입니다.
# + 변경: 서버 응답 시간은 평균 150ms로 개선되었습니다.
Word 파일은 바이너리 형식이므로 Git으로 diff를 확인할 수 없습니다. 변경 이력 추적은 Word의 내장 기능에 의존해야 합니다.
3. 파일 크기가 작다
1,000단어 분량의 문서를 비교하면 차이가 뚜렷합니다.
| 형식 | 파일 크기 |
|---|---|
| .md (마크다운) | ~5 KB |
| .docx (Word) | ~30 KB |
| .docx (이미지 포함) | ~500 KB 이상 |
마크다운 파일은 이메일 첨부, 메신저 전송, 클라우드 저장 등 어디에서든 부담 없이 공유할 수 있습니다.
4. 내용에 집중할 수 있다
마크다운에서는 서식을 고르느라 시간을 낭비하지 않습니다. 폰트를 바꾸거나 색상을 고를 필요 없이, 구조와 내용에 집중할 수 있습니다. 최종 스타일은 변환 단계에서 일괄 적용하면 됩니다.
5. 자동화와 통합이 쉽다
마크다운은 텍스트 기반이므로 스크립트로 처리하기 쉽습니다.
# 모든 마크다운 파일에서 특정 텍스트 치환
sed -i 's/old-url.com/new-url.com/g' docs/*.md
# 여러 파일을 하나의 PDF로 합치기
cat intro.md chapter1.md chapter2.md | md-to-pdf
CI/CD 파이프라인에서 문서를 자동으로 빌드하고 배포하는 것도 가능합니다.
Word의 장점
1. 실시간 공동 편집
Microsoft 365의 실시간 공동 편집 기능은 마크다운으로는 따라하기 어렵습니다. 여러 사람이 동시에 같은 문서를 편집하면서 변경 사항을 즉시 확인할 수 있습니다.
2. 풍부한 서식 옵션
Word는 글꼴, 색상, 크기, 간격, 머리글/바닥글, 목차 자동 생성, 페이지 번호 등 세밀한 서식 설정이 가능합니다. 마크다운은 이런 부분에서 제한적입니다.
3. 비개발자와의 협업
마크다운 문법을 모르는 사람에게는 Word가 더 편합니다. 특히 경영진, 마케팅, 영업 등 비개발 직군과 협업할 때는 Word가 현실적인 선택입니다.
4. 검토 및 주석 기능
Word의 변경 내용 추적과 주석 기능은 문서 검토 워크플로우에 최적화되어 있습니다. 마크다운에서는 PR 리뷰로 대체할 수 있지만, 비개발자에게는 익숙하지 않습니다.
5. 복잡한 레이아웃
다단 편집, 텍스트 상자, 도형 삽입, 워터마크 등 복잡한 레이아웃이 필요한 문서에는 Word가 적합합니다.
상황별 추천
마크다운이 적합한 경우
- 기술 문서: API 문서, 개발 가이드, README
- 블로그 포스트: 특히 기술 블로그
- 개인 메모/노트: 빠른 기록과 정리
- 버전 관리가 필요한 문서: 정책 문서, 규격 문서
- 개발팀 내부 문서: 위키, 온보딩 가이드
- 이력서: 코드처럼 관리하는 이력서 (printmd로 PDF 변환)
Word가 적합한 경우
- 공식 비즈니스 문서: 계약서, 제안서, 견적서
- 비개발자와의 협업: 마케팅 자료, 기획 문서
- 복잡한 레이아웃: 보고서, 매뉴얼, 소책자
- 학술 논문: 저널 투고 양식이 Word를 요구하는 경우
- 서식이 중요한 문서: 정부 제출 문서, 법률 문서
둘 다 사용하는 하이브리드 접근
실무에서는 하나만 고집하기보다 상황에 따라 적절히 혼용하는 것이 좋습니다.
- 초안은 마크다운으로: 빠르게 내용을 작성합니다.
- 검토는 상황에 따라: 개발팀이면 PR 리뷰, 비개발팀이면 Word 변환 후 검토합니다.
- 최종본은 필요에 따라: 웹 배포면 마크다운, 인쇄면 PDF, 공유면 Word로 변환합니다.
마크다운에서 Word로, Word에서 마크다운으로
마크다운 -> Word
Pandoc을 사용하면 마크다운을 Word 파일로 변환할 수 있습니다.
pandoc document.md -o document.docx
스타일 템플릿을 지정하면 더 깔끔한 결과를 얻을 수 있습니다.
pandoc document.md -o document.docx --reference-doc=template.docx
Word -> 마크다운
pandoc document.docx -o document.md
다만 Word의 복잡한 서식은 마크다운으로 완벽히 변환되지 않을 수 있습니다. 변환 후 수동 정리가 필요할 수 있습니다.
마크다운 -> PDF
마크다운을 PDF로 변환하면 Word 못지않게 깔끔한 문서를 만들 수 있습니다. printmd를 사용하면 별도의 설정 없이 한글 문서도 깔끔하게 PDF로 변환됩니다.
생산성 비교
실제 작업 속도를 비교해보겠습니다.
문서 작성 속도
| 작업 | 마크다운 | Word |
|---|---|---|
| 제목 추가 | ## 제목 (1초) |
텍스트 입력 -> 스타일 선택 (3초) |
| 굵은 글씨 | **텍스트** (1초) |
텍스트 선택 -> Ctrl+B (2초) |
| 코드 삽입 | 백틱 3개 (1초) | 서식 변경 여러 단계 (10초) |
| 목록 작성 | - 항목 (즉시) |
자동 목록 (비슷) |
| 표 작성 | 파이프 문법 (보통) | GUI로 삽입 (쉬움) |
키보드에서 손을 떼지 않고 작업할 수 있다는 점에서 마크다운이 전반적으로 빠릅니다. 하지만 표 작성이나 이미지 배치 같은 작업은 Word의 GUI가 더 직관적입니다.
파일 관리 효율
# 마크다운: 폴더 기반으로 깔끔하게 정리
docs/
├── api/
│ ├── authentication.md
│ └── endpoints.md
└── guides/
├── getting-started.md
└── deployment.md
# Word: 파일 이름으로만 구분
문서/
├── API_인증_가이드_v3_최종_진짜최종.docx
├── API_엔드포인트_수정본.docx
└── 시작하기_김대리수정_0220.docx
이 차이는 프로젝트가 커질수록 더 두드러집니다.
마무리
마크다운과 Word는 경쟁 관계가 아니라 보완 관계입니다. 각각의 강점이 있고, 최적의 사용 시나리오가 다릅니다. 개발 관련 문서에는 마크다운이, 비즈니스 커뮤니케이션에는 Word가 더 적합합니다.
중요한 것은 도구에 얽매이지 않는 것입니다. 내용이 좋으면 어떤 형식이든 가치가 있습니다. 다만 효율적인 도구를 선택하면 같은 시간에 더 좋은 결과물을 만들 수 있습니다. 마크다운이 익숙해지면 printmd 같은 도구를 활용해 PDF나 인쇄 가능한 형태로 쉽게 변환할 수 있으니, 마크다운을 아직 사용해보지 않았다면 한 번 도전해보시기 바랍니다.